Key Takeaways:

  • Pollinators, including bees, butterflies, and birds, are experiencing significant population declines due to habitat loss, pesticide use, and climate change.
  • Urbanization and agricultural expansion have led to the destruction of vital habitats, making it difficult for pollinators to find food and nesting sites.
  • Pesticides, particularly neonicotinoids, have been linked to adverse health effects in pollinators, including impaired foraging behavior and weakened immune systems.
  • Climate change has disrupted the timing of flowering plants and the pollinators that depend on them, leading to mismatches in availability.
  • Conservation efforts can include planting native flowers, reducing pesticide use, and creating pollinator-friendly environments in gardens and farms.
  • Public awareness and education about the importance of pollinators can drive community action and support for local conservation initiatives.
  • Collaboration among farmers, policymakers, and conservation organizations is vital to implement effective strategies that promote pollinator health and biodiversity.

Climate Chaos: How Weather Pattern Changes Affect Pollinators

Climate change isn’t just a scientific debate; it’s a stark reality impacting the delicate world of pollinators. Climate fluctuations are messing with weather patterns, and guess who’s at the mercy of that chaos? That’s right, your buzzing buddies! Changes in temperature and humidity can lead to mismatched flowering times, meaning that by the time a bee emerges to do its vital work, *your* favorite plants might have already bloomed and dropped their nectar.

Consequently, as temperatures continue to rise, the lifecycle sync that we’ve come to take for granted faces disruption. Your local blossoms may bloom earlier, while pollinators stick to their old schedules, leading to a disconnect that echoes throughout entire ecosystems. As a direct result, your pollinators face declining food sources just when they need them the most, making survival an uphill battle—talk about the uninvited guest at the garden party.

Gardening with Purpose: Creating Pollinator Habitats

Pollinator habitats aren’t just for the fanciful gardeners; they are your green battlegrounds against extinction! You can transform your outdoor spaces into thriving pluralistic jungles that welcome bees, butterflies, and other buzzing buddies. Start by selecting a variety of native plants that bloom at different seasons to ensure continuous food sources. Think of it like hosting a buffet – a little something for everyone, from nectar-rich flowers to leafy greens.

When you plant your pollinator paradise, be mindful of water sources so your feathered friends can sip away as they frolic among the flowers. Incorporate elements like small puddles or shallow dishes filled with marbles or pebbles to create safe access for thirsty insects. With a little planning and care, your garden can quickly become a must-visit destination on the pollinator’s travel map!

FAQ

Q: What are pollinators, and why are they important?

A: Pollinators include creatures like bees, butterflies, birds, and bats that play a significant role in the reproductive process of flowering plants. They help in the transfer of pollen, which enables plants to produce fruits and seeds. This process is vital for ecosystem health and agricultural productivity, as over 75% of the world’s food crops rely on pollination.

Q: What factors are contributing to the decline of pollinators?

A: The decline of pollinators can be attributed to several factors including habitat loss due to urbanization and agriculture, pesticide use that harms pollinator populations, climate change that alters habitats and food availability, and diseases that affect pollinator health. Each of these factors contributes to the overall decline in pollinator diversity and numbers.

Q: How does habitat loss affect pollinators?

A: Habitat loss reduces the availability of food sources and nesting sites for pollinators. Many pollinators require specific types of plants for foraging and breeding. When natural habitats are destroyed or fragmented, it limits their ability to find these resources, leading to declines in their populations.

Q: What role do pesticides play in the decline of pollinators?

A: Pesticides, especially neonicotinoids, have been shown to have harmful effects on pollinator health. These chemicals can impair navigation, foraging behavior, and reproduction in pollinators. As a result, the exposure to pesticides can lead to decreased populations and disrupted ecosystems.

Q: How is climate change impacting pollinators?

A: Climate change alters the timing of flowering plants and pollinator activity, creating mismatches in the availability of flowers and their pollinators. It can also shift the geographical distribution of species, making some areas inhospitable for certain pollinators while favoring the growth of invasive species that can suppress native pollinator populations.

Q: What actions can individuals take to support pollinator populations?

A: Individuals can help by planting native flowering plants that provide food for pollinators, avoiding the use of harmful pesticides in their gardens, creating habitats such as bee hotels, and supporting local organic farming. Additionally, people can educate others about the importance of pollinators and advocate for policies that protect them.

Q: What is the role of government and organizations in pollinator conservation?

A: Governments and organizations play an important role by implementing policies that protect natural habitats, regulating pesticide use, supporting research on pollinator health, and promoting public awareness campaigns. Collaborative efforts between various stakeholders, including farmers, scientists, and conservationists, are necessary for developing effective conservation strategies.
